Removal & Installation

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2003 Jaguar XJ8, 2003 Jaguar XJ, 2002 Jaguar XJ8, 2002 Jaguar XJ, and 2001 Jaguar XJ8.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Remove the transmission unit from the vehicle. See REMOVAL .
  2. Remove the torque converter from the transmission unit.
    • Install lifting handles 307-139.
    Fig 1: Removing Torque Converter
    G00378880Courtesy of JAGUAR CARS, INC.
  3. Remove lifting handles 307-139 from the torque converter.
  4. Clean the torque converter and mating faces.
  5. CAUTION: Use extreme care NOT to damage the oil seal with the converter.
    CAUTION: Ensure that the converter is fully located.
  6. Install the torque converter.
    1. Install lifting handles 307-139.
    2. Lubricate the front pump seal.
      • To facilitate location, rotate the converter as it is being fitted and note the engagement of splines and oil pump drive.
        Fig 2: Installing Torque Converter
        G00378881Courtesy of JAGUAR CARS, INC.
  7. Check that the three converter fixing boss faces are approximately 8,0 mm proud of the transmission mounting face.
  8. Remove lifting handles 307-139 from the torque converter.
  9. Install the transmission unit; refer to INSTALLATION , noting especially the alignment instructions.
